Enhanced urea filtration

The purity of AdBlue® (AUS32) is absolutely paramount for the protection and longevity of Selective Catalytic Reduction (SCR) systems. Even microscopic particulate impurities can lead to blockages or damage within the catalytic converter, resulting in costly repairs and reduced engine efficiency. While our standard AdBlue® Production Line models incorporate robust multi-stage filtration systems designed to meet ISO 22241 standards, some operational environments or specific applications demand an even higher level of purity assurance.

For such demanding scenarios, Atmosfer Makina offers an enhanced urea filtration option. This advanced feature integrates additional, finer filtration stages directly into the AdBlue® manufacturing process. This means that after the urea for DEF has been dissolved in demineralized water, the resulting solution undergoes an even more rigorous purification. This optional filtration mechanism captures the minutest insoluble particles, ensuring that the final AUS32 product is exceptionally pure.

This enhanced urea filtration is particularly beneficial for clients who:

  • Operate in highly sensitive environments where even minimal impurities could pose a risk.
  • Procure urea for DEF from sources where consistency in purity might occasionally vary, requiring an additional safeguard.
  • Wish to maximize the lifespan and performance of their SCR systems by providing the cleanest possible AdBlue®.

By choosing the enhanced urea filtration option, you invest in an added layer of quality assurance, further protecting your valuable diesel engine assets and guaranteeing the highest possible standard for your on-site AdBlue® production.

Low energy heating

Maintaining optimal temperature during the urea dissolution process is crucial for efficient and consistent AdBlue® manufacturing. In colder climates or during winter months, the temperature of incoming demineralized water can drop, slowing down the dissolution rate of urea for DEF and potentially impacting production capacity. Traditional heating methods can be energy-intensive, adding to operational costs.

Atmosfer Makina addresses this challenge with our low energy heating option for the AdBlue® Production Line. This feature incorporates highly efficient heating elements and advanced temperature control systems that are specifically designed to minimize energy consumption while effectively warming the demineralized water to the ideal temperature range for urea dissolution (typically between 25-40°C).

The benefits of implementing a low energy heating system include:

  • Consistent Production Rates: Ensures that the dissolution process remains efficient regardless of ambient temperature, maintaining stable AUS32 output.
  • Optimized Dissolution: Warmer water accelerates the dissolution of urea for DEF, reducing batch times and increasing overall efficiency of the AdBlue® manufacturing process.
  • Reduced Energy Costs: Utilizes advanced, energy-efficient technology to minimize power consumption, contributing to lower operational expenditures over the long term.
  • Prevents Crystallization: Helps prevent the formation of urea crystals, which can occur if dissolution is inefficient in cold conditions, safeguarding system components.

This low energy heating option is a smart investment for any AdBlue® Production Line operating in variable climates, ensuring uninterrupted and cost-effective AUS32 manufacturing throughout the year.

Storage

Once the AdBlue® (AUS32) has been produced to the highest quality standards by our AdBlue® Production Line, efficient and safe storage becomes a critical next step before distribution or direct use. Atmosfer Makina offers a range of comprehensive storage solutions designed to seamlessly integrate with your AdBlue® manufacturing process, ensuring the integrity and ready availability of your finished product.

Proper storage is vital to maintain the quality and extend the shelf life of AdBlue®. AdBlue® is sensitive to contamination and extreme temperatures. Our storage solutions are engineered with these factors in mind:

  • Material Compatibility: Our storage tanks are constructed from materials that are fully compatible with AdBlue®, such as high-grade stainless steel or specific types of high-density polyethylene (HDPE). These materials prevent any chemical reactions that could contaminate or degrade the AUS32, ensuring it remains ISO 22241 compliant.
  • Capacity Options: We offer a wide variety of storage capacities to match your AdBlue® production line’s output and your consumption needs. Whether you require small buffer tanks or large bulk storage solutions capable of holding thousands of liters of DEF, we have an option for you.
  • Temperature Control Features: For regions with extreme climates, our storage tanks can be equipped with insulation and, if necessary, heating or cooling systems. This helps maintain AdBlue® within its ideal storage temperature range (typically -11°C to 30°C), protecting it from freezing in very cold conditions or from thermal degradation in very hot environments. This ensures product stability and performance over time.
  • Integrated Level Monitoring: Our storage tanks come with integrated level sensors that provide real-time inventory data. This allows for precise monitoring of stock levels, enabling efficient planning for production batches and preventing costly shortages. Automated alerts can be configured to notify operators when AdBlue® levels are low or critical.
  • Ventilation and Sealing: Proper tank design includes features for adequate ventilation to prevent vacuum or pressure buildup during filling and dispensing. Simultaneously, the tanks are sealed to protect the AUS32 from airborne contaminants, dust, and light exposure, all of which can degrade AdBlue® quality.

By offering these robust storage solutions, Atmosfer Makina ensures that the high-quality AdBlue® produced by your AdBlue® Production Line remains pristine until it’s needed, providing a complete and reliable on-site AdBlue® supply chain.

Packaging solution

After your AdBlue® Production Line has efficiently manufactured high-quality AUS32, the final stage often involves transferring the finished product for distribution or immediate use. Atmosfer Makina provides comprehensive packaging solution options designed to streamline this process, ensuring efficient, accurate, and safe handling of your self-produced AdBlue® (DEF). Our solutions cater to a variety of dispensing and distribution needs, from bulk transfers to individual container filling.

Our packaging solution options are integrated with the output of your AdBlue® manufacturing process or directly with your storage tanks, creating a seamless workflow:

  • Bulk Loading Systems: For clients requiring large volumes of AdBlue® for their own fleets or for sale to other bulk consumers, we offer automated bulk loading stations. These systems are equipped with high-capacity pumps, precision flow meters, and articulated loading arms that allow for rapid and safe transfer of AUS32 into tanker trucks. Automated shut-off valves prevent overfilling, ensuring efficient and mess-free operations. These systems are ideal for large logistics centers, fuel depots, or major industrial sites.
  • IBC Tank Filling Stations: Intermediate Bulk Containers (IBC Tanks) are a popular choice for storing and transporting AdBlue® in manageable quantities (typically 1000 liters). We provide specialized filling stations designed specifically for IBC Tanks. These stations ensure accurate filling volumes, minimize spillage, and can be automated for high throughput. This packaging solution is perfect for clients who distribute AdBlue® to multiple internal departments, smaller client sites, or for resale in medium volumes. Our solutions can include features for automatic cap placement and sealing for enhanced efficiency.
  • Drum and Small Container Filling Lines: For operations that require distributing AdBlue® in smaller volumes, such as 200-liter drums or even smaller containers (e.g., 10-liter jugs), Atmosfer Makina offers semi-automated or fully automated filling lines. These systems are designed for precision filling, minimizing product waste and ensuring consistent packaging. They are ideal for retail distribution, service stations, or internal use where smaller, portable quantities are preferred.
  • Integrated Weighing and Labeling: To ensure accuracy and compliance, our packaging solution options can include integrated weighing systems for precise volume verification and automated labeling machines. This streamlines the entire post-production process, making the AdBlue® manufacturing process complete from raw urea for DEF to ready-to-distribute product.

Every packaging solution we offer is designed with a strong emphasis on safety, incorporating features such as spill containment, emergency stop buttons, and operator-friendly interfaces. By providing these comprehensive packaging solution options, Atmosfer Makina empowers you to not only produce high-quality AdBlue® efficiently but also to manage its storage and distribution effectively, securing your entire AdBlue® supply chain and maximizing the value of your AdBlue® Production Line.
